Transaction 13d6be16589de1afeb0d69cd7f82a898bc390b6679a8bc02ba02acb0d4e14de5

2 Input
2 Outputs
  • 13d6be16589de1afeb0d69cd7f82a898bc390b6679a8bc02ba02acb0d4e14de5:0
  • value  168760000
    address  17H9ELhvyGRScG7bkEeaiUXjhZWjbZhzgk
  • 13d6be16589de1afeb0d69cd7f82a898bc390b6679a8bc02ba02acb0d4e14de5:1
  • value  157451
    address  1HhFtndMooKk24G1rGyMoLdtTM9qr5dCTW